"Miss Sattie Butler," two photographs taken by Rufus W. Holsinger on August 23, 1915 and February 6, 1917.

Note that the man photographed is Dr. George Ferguson (P48189) and the portrait is the same, laterally reversed, as one labelled Dr. G. R. Ferguson.

Additional information about Miss Sattie Butler will be added as it is researched.

NOTE that the name with which the portrait is labelled is not necessarily the name of the sitter(s) in the portrait, but rather the name of the person who paid for the portrait when it was taken (the date and name associated with each photograph is from the business ledgers of R. W. Holsinger).
